CASE OF CONNER

No. LD-2008-005.

965 A.2d 1130 (2009)

CONNER'S CASE.

Supreme Court of New Hampshire.

Opinion Issued: January 29, 2009.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Landya B. McCafferty, of Concord, on the brief and orally, for the professional conduct committee.

William E. Conner, on the memorandum of law and orally, pro se.


DUGGAN, J.

On July 8, 2008, the Supreme Court Professional Conduct Committee (PCC) filed a petition recommending that the respondent, William E. Conner, be disbarred but that he be permitted to reapply for admission to the bar after three years, subject to his compliance with certain conditions. We order the respondent disbarred.
